有没有推荐的Python机器学习第三方库?
时间: 2024-08-02 08:01:00 浏览: 98
当然有。Python拥有丰富的机器学习生态系统,以下是一些非常流行的第三方库:
1. **NumPy**:用于处理大型多维数组和矩阵的基础库,是科学计算的重要组件。
2. **Pandas**:提供数据结构DataFrame,使得数据清洗、转换和分析变得简单高效。
3. **Scikit-learn (sklearn)**:最常用的机器学习库之一,包含各种监督和无监督的学习算法。
4. **TensorFlow**:由Google开源的强大深度学习框架,支持构建和训练复杂的神经网络模型。
5. **Keras**:基于TensorFlow或Theano的高级神经网络API,易于上手。
6. **PyTorch**:另一个强大的深度学习框架,以其动态图机制著称,适合研究实验。
7. **Matplotlib**:用于数据可视化,展示机器学习模型的输出结果。
8. **Seaborn**:建立在Matplotlib之上,提供了更高级别的统计图形。
9. **Scipy**:包括优化、积分、线性代数等多个科学计算功能。
10. **XGBoost**:高效的梯度提升库,特别擅长分类和回归任务。
阅读全文